1.1. What is OBD2?

OBD2, or On-Board Diagnostics II, is a standardized system used in most vehicles manufactured after 1996. This system monitors various engine and vehicle parameters, such as emissions, engine performance, and sensor data. The OBD2 port allows mechanics and vehicle owners to access this data using a scan tool. According to the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), OBD2 was mandated to ensure vehicles meet strict emission standards, making it a crucial component for modern vehicle diagnostics.

1.3. How the Mini V2.1 Bluetooth OBD2 Scan Tool Works

The mini v2.1 Bluetooth OBD2 car diagnostic scan tool works by establishing a connection between your vehicle’s OBD2 port and your smartphone or tablet. Here’s a step-by-step breakdown:

  1. Plug in the Scan Tool: Locate the OBD2 port in your vehicle (usually under the dashboard) and plug in the scan tool.
  2. Pair with Your Device: Enable Bluetooth on your smartphone or tablet and pair it with the scan tool.
  3. Launch the App: Download and install a compatible OBD2 app (such as Torque Pro, OBD Fusion, or Car Scanner ELM OBD2) and launch it.
  4. Connect to the Vehicle: Within the app, connect to the scan tool. The app will then communicate with your vehicle’s computer.
  5. Read Data: Access real-time data, read fault codes, and perform other diagnostic functions through the app.

1.4. Limitations of the Mini V2.1 Bluetooth OBD2 Scan Tool

While the mini v2.1 Bluetooth OBD2 car diagnostic scan tool is a useful tool, it does have some limitations:

  • Compatibility Issues: May not be fully compatible with all vehicle makes and models, especially older vehicles or those with proprietary systems.
  • Basic Functionality: Offers primarily basic diagnostic functions; more advanced features may require a professional-grade scan tool.
  • Potential for Bugs: Some users have reported issues with connectivity and data accuracy, particularly with cheaper, generic versions of the tool. As noted by a study from the Society of Automotive Engineers (SAE), the reliability of aftermarket OBD2 scan tools can vary significantly.

4. Choosing the Right OBD2 App for Your Mini V2.1 Bluetooth Scan Tool

Selecting the right OBD2 app is crucial for maximizing the benefits of your mini v2.1 Bluetooth OBD2 car diagnostic scan tool. Here are some popular and highly-rated apps:

4.1. Torque Pro

Torque Pro is one of the most popular OBD2 apps, known for its extensive features and customization options.

  • Key Features: Real-time data, DTC reading and resetting, customizable dashboards, data logging, GPS tracking, and dyno/horsepower measurement.
  • Pros: Highly customizable, extensive feature set, large user community, and support for custom PIDs.
  • Cons: Paid app, can be overwhelming for beginners due to the number of features.

4.2. OBD Fusion

OBD Fusion is another excellent choice, offering a balance of features and ease of use.

  • Key Features: Real-time data, DTC reading and resetting, customizable dashboards, data logging, emission readiness testing, and support for multiple vehicle profiles.
  • Pros: User-friendly interface, comprehensive feature set, support for both iOS and Android, and affordable price.
  • Cons: Some advanced features require in-app purchases.

4.3. Car Scanner ELM OBD2

Car Scanner ELM OBD2 is a free app with a wide range of features and support for multiple vehicle brands.

  • Key Features: Real-time data, DTC reading and resetting, customizable dashboards, data logging, support for extended PIDs, and specialized features for specific vehicle brands (e.g., Toyota, BMW).
  • Pros: Free, extensive feature set, support for custom PIDs, and specialized features for specific vehicle brands.
  • Cons: May contain ads, some advanced features require a paid subscription.

4.4. DashCommand

DashCommand is a visually appealing app that offers a variety of gauges and performance metrics.

  • Key Features: Real-time data, DTC reading and resetting, customizable dashboards, performance calculations (e.g., 0-60 mph), and data logging.
  • Pros: Visually appealing interface, performance calculations, support for custom PIDs, and available for both iOS and Android.
  • Cons: Paid app, some features require additional in-app purchases.

5. Troubleshooting Common Issues with the Mini V2.1 Bluetooth OBD2 Scan Tool

While the mini v2.1 Bluetooth OBD2 car diagnostic scan tool is generally reliable, users may encounter some common issues. Here are some troubleshooting tips:

5.1. Connectivity Problems

One of the most common issues is difficulty connecting the scan tool to your smartphone or tablet.

  • Ensure Bluetooth is Enabled: Make sure Bluetooth is turned on in your device’s settings.
  • Pair the Devices: Ensure the scan tool is properly paired with your device.
  • Check Compatibility: Verify that the scan tool and app are compatible with your device’s operating system.
  • Restart Devices: Try restarting both the scan tool and your smartphone or tablet.
  • Update Firmware: Check for firmware updates for the scan tool and install them if available.

5.2. Inaccurate Data Readings

Inaccurate data readings can be caused by various factors, including faulty sensors or compatibility issues.

  • Verify Sensor Functionality: Check the functionality of the sensors in your vehicle.
  • Check Compatibility: Ensure the scan tool and app are fully compatible with your vehicle’s make and model.
  • Use a Reliable App: Use a reputable OBD2 app known for its accuracy.
  • Calibrate Sensors: Some apps allow you to calibrate sensors for more accurate readings.

5.3. App Crashes and Freezing

App crashes and freezing can be frustrating, but there are several steps you can take to resolve these issues.

  • Update the App: Ensure you are using the latest version of the OBD2 app.
  • Clear Cache and Data: Clear the app’s cache and data in your device’s settings.
  • Reinstall the App: Try uninstalling and reinstalling the app.
  • Check Device Resources: Make sure your device has enough memory and processing power to run the app smoothly.

5.4. Check Engine Light Not Resetting

If you are unable to reset the check engine light after addressing the underlying issue, try the following:

  • Verify the Repair: Ensure the underlying issue has been properly resolved.
  • Clear All Codes: Clear all diagnostic trouble codes, not just the one that triggered the check engine light.
  • Drive Cycle: Perform a drive cycle to allow the vehicle’s computer to re-evaluate the system.

5.5. Scan Tool Not Recognized by Vehicle

If the scan tool is not recognized by your vehicle, try the following:

  • Check OBD2 Port: Ensure the OBD2 port is clean and free of debris.
  • Verify Compatibility: Verify that the scan tool is compatible with your vehicle’s make and model.
  • Try a Different Vehicle: Test the scan tool on another vehicle to determine if the issue is with the scan tool or your vehicle.
